Palazzo, Francesco, and Roberto Bartoli, eds. La mediazione penale nel diritto italiano e internazionale. Florence: Firenze University Press, 2011. http://dx.doi.org/10.36253/978-88-6453-249-3.

Full text
Abstract:
This book contains the proceedings of the first day of the conference Strumenti alternativi di composizione dei conflitti: la mediazione civile e penale (Alternative instruments for the settlement of disputes: civil and criminal mediation), held in Florence on 20 and 21 October 2010. In recent years criminal mediation has been the subject of acute academic reflection, beginning to open a breach in both legislation and practice. Moreover, mediation has found a consistent and real application within the international perspective. This has opened up new scenarios in which the response to offences expressing a significant illegality is broken down in line with the two paradigms of judicial and "transactional", and within which these paradigms are becoming increasingly integrated.

Karakaş, Işıl, and Hasan Bakırcı. Extraterritorial Application of the European Convention on Human Rights. Oxford University Press, 2018. http://dx.doi.org/10.1093/oso/9780198830009.003.0007.

Full text
Abstract:
This chapter analyses the evolution of the Strasbourg case law on the concept of jurisdiction within the meaning of Article 1 of the European Convention on Human Rights by attempting to provide a comprehensive answer to the question of extraterritorial jurisdiction. It ascertains whether there exists any truth in the criticism directed towards the European Court of Human Rights’ case law and, most importantly, any room for its further development. The chapter will first examine the early jurisprudence of the Convention bodies and explain how they dealt with the difficult question of extraterritorial jurisdiction. It will then discuss the two tests developed by the Court when determining extraterritorial jurisdiction in various case scenarios. Finally, the concluding section of the chapter will summarize these discussions and pose a question for future development of the Court’s case law.

Leech, Geoffrey. Pragmatics and Dialogue. Edited by Ruslan Mitkov. Oxford University Press, 2012. http://dx.doi.org/10.1093/oxfordhb/9780199276349.013.0007.

Full text
Abstract:
This article introduces the linguistic subdiscipline of pragmatics and shows how this is being applied to the development of spoken dialogue systems — currently perhaps the most important applications area for computational pragmatics. It traces the history of pragmatics from its philosophical roots, and outlines some key notions of theoretical pragmatics — speech acts, illocutionary force, the cooperative principle and relevance. It then discusses the application of pragmatics to dialogue modelling, especially the development of spoken dialogue systems intended to interact with human beings in task-oriented scenarios such as providing travel information and shows how and why computational pragmatics differs from ‘linguistic’ pragmatics, and how pragmatics contributes to the computational analysis of dialogues. One major illustration of this is the application of speech act theory in the analysis and synthesis of service interactions in terms of dialogue acts.

Downey, James, and Michael Cohen. Endogenous Mechanisms of Cardioprotection. Oxford University Press, 2011. http://dx.doi.org/10.1093/med/9780199544769.003.0008.

Full text
Abstract:
• Ischaemic preconditioning is the most powerful endogenous mechanism for limiting myocardial infarct size in the experimental setting. Its clinical application is limited to scenarios in which the index episode of ischaemia and reperfusion can be anticipated such as in the setting of cardiac surgery• Ischaemic postconditioning represents an endogenous cardioprotective strategy which is applied at the onset of myocardial reperfusion, thereby allowing its use as an adjunct to reperfusion in patients presenting with an acute myocardial infarction• Both ischaemic preconditioning and postconditioning recruit a common signal transduction pathway at the time of myocardial reperfusion, which can be targeted by pharmacological agents administered as adjuncts to reperfusion.

Pearce, Jane. Family therapy. Oxford University Press, 2013. http://dx.doi.org/10.1093/med/9780199644957.003.0020.

Full text
Abstract:
This chapter introduces Family Therapy (Systemic Therapy) as a psychotherapeutic approach which explores the patient’s problems in relational terms rather than treating them as if they reside in the patient alone. The focus is upon the dynamic, interactive connections between people and their wider social context and the history of evolving ideas and practices is summarised. The evidence of effectiveness of family therapy in adults is discussed and the implication drawn that there is evidence to support clinical application including older age populations. The chapter illustrates the range of ideas that have been found applicable and helpful in work with older people and illustrates some of these approaches with practice based scenarios from old age psychiatry.

Strada, E. Alessandra. The Eighth Domain of Palliative Care. Oxford University Press, 2018. http://dx.doi.org/10.1093/med/9780199798551.003.0009.

Full text
Abstract:
This chapter discusses palliative psychology competencies in the eighth domain of palliative care, which addresses the legal and ethical aspects of palliative care. Firstly, the chapter reviews psychology ethical standards and principles discussing their application and relevance to the palliative care setting. Palliative psychology competencies are presented. Additionally, principles of medical ethics related to decision making are discussed. Complex case scenarios are discussed with the aid of clinical case vignettes. In particular, the discussion focuses on the ethical issues related to disclosure of a terminal prognosis, family conflicts, and intimate partner violence of patients with advanced illness. Psychological approaches and interventions are discussed in the context of the interdisciplinary palliative care tem approach.

Narayana, Shalini, Babak Saboury, Andrew B. Newberg, Andrew C. Papanicolaou, and Abass Alavi. Positron Emission Tomography. Edited by Andrew C. Papanicolaou. Oxford University Press, 2014. http://dx.doi.org/10.1093/oxfordhb/9780199764228.013.8.

Full text
Abstract:
Positron emission tomography (PET) is an imaging method that utilizes compounds labeled with positron-emitting radioisotopes as molecular probes to evaluate different neurophysiological processes quantitatively and noninvasively. This chapter provides a background regarding positron emission, radiotracer chemistry, and detector and scanner instrumentation, as well as analytical methods for evaluating basic brain physiology, such as cerebral blood flow and oxygen and glucose metabolism. The methodological aspects of PET imaging, such as patient preparation and optimal scanning parameters, are discussed. Examples of application of blood flow and metabolic imaging in both research and clinical scenarios for the evaluation of normal neurophysiology are provided. Recent advances in PET imaging, including PET-CT and PET-MRI, are also described. Finally, the unique strengths of PET imaging are highlighted.

Strada, E. Alessandra. The First Domain of Palliative Care. Oxford University Press, 2018. http://dx.doi.org/10.1093/med/9780199798551.003.0002.

Full text
Abstract:
This chapter proposes palliative psychology competencies in the first domain of palliative care based on the framework of the Clinical Practice Guidelines for Quality Palliative Care. Competencies are conceptualized as comprising knowledge, skills, and attitudes. The role of palliative psychologists is presented through the discussion of clinical case scenarios. These roles for psychologists are discussed in the context of different palliative care settings (inpatient; outpatient, home-based palliative care, hospice). The relevant application of clinical skills is discussed. The difference between palliative care and hospice is also presented. Finally, this chapter approaches the topic of professional self-care, which is conceptualized as a necessary competence for palliative psychologists. The discussion presents risk factors, protective factors, and interventions especially relevant to palliative psychologists.

Stefan, Vogenauer. Ch.1 General Provisions, Introduction to Chapter 1 of the PICC. Oxford University Press, 2015. http://dx.doi.org/10.1093/law/9780198702627.003.0004.

Full text
Abstract:
This chapter contains three groups of ‘general provisions’ of the UNIDROIT Principles of International Commercial Contracts (PICC). The first group deals with fundamental principles of contract law, including freedom of contract, freedom from formal requirements, the bindingness of contract, good faith and fair dealing, and the so-called ‘prohibition of inconsistent behaviour’. The second group of provisions addresses the role and function of mandatory rules and the third group deals with the application of the PICC, focusing on general guidelines for the interpretation of the various articles of the instrument; specific key terms that are used throughout the following Chapters of the PICC such as ‘court’, ‘place of business’, ‘obligor’, ‘obligee’, and ‘writing’; the role of usages and practices established between the parties; and rules for certain scenarios that may arise in various contexts if the PICC apply.

George A, Bermann. Part II Investor-State Arbitration in the Energy Sector, 9 ECT and European Union Law. Oxford University Press, 2018. http://dx.doi.org/10.1093/law/9780198805786.003.0009.

Full text
Abstract:
This chapter also looks at issues that typically arise in Energy Charter Treaty (ECT) cases. In particular, it explores those cases in which respondent states have made use of EU law in mounting a jurisdictional or substantive defence under the ECT. First, regarding EU law as a jurisdictional defence, the chapter looks both at intra-European BIT cases and intra-European ECT cases. Regarding the latter, the chapter addresses, among other things, the critical question of whether the ECT is applicable to disputes between an EU member state and a national of another EU member state, or whether such application is precluded by an implicit ‘disconnection clause’ under the ECT, as argued by the EU Commission. Second, regarding EU law as a substantive defence, the chapter analyzes scenarios in which EU law arguably requires conduct, on the part of a member state, that the ECT itself forbids, or vice versa.
